Historical Accomplishments of Maryland College Soccer Teams

Maryland’s college soccer landscape featured several prominent teams that have made their mark in the history of college soccer. The University of Maryland College Park, for example, has a men’s soccer team that has won several NCAA Division I titles, positioning it as one of the most successful teams nationally. Johns Hopkins University’s men’s and women’s soccer teams consistently rank among the country’s top Division III programs. Similarly, Salisbury University has had significant success in the Division III ranks, as well. Navy’s men team and Loyola’s women’s team have achieved substantial recognition in the realm of college soccer, showcasing excellent performances in their respective leagues and divisions.

Affiliation of Maryland’s College Soccer Teams

Various Maryland’s college soccer teams are affiliated with NCAA Division I, Division II, or Division III. University of Maryland – Baltimore County, Towson University, Navy College, and Loyola University Maryland are among the prominent universities that actively participate in Division I college soccer. Frostburg State University is Maryland’s leading representative in Division II, while schools such as Salisbury University, McDaniel College, and Johns Hopkins University prove to be competitive powerhouses in Division III.

Profiles of Top Maryland College Soccer Teams

Spotlight on the University of Maryland Men’s Soccer Program

With one of the leading soccer programs on a national scale, the University of Maryland, College Park, flaunts their Men’s Soccer team, lovingly referred to as the Terrapins or the “Terps.” This outstanding team, formed in 1946, has an impressive legacy of numerous conference and national championships under its belt. Sasho Cirovski, one of their most celebrated coaches, has been leading the team since 1993 and has guided the Terps to national championships in 2005, 2008, and 2018.

The team’s track record also includes nurturing numerous players who later had successful professional soccer careers, including football luminaries such as Taylor Twellman, a previous striker for the US national team, and Omar Gonzalez, recognizable for his role as a center back in Major League Soccer. With their consistent development of notable young talents, the Terps have solidified Maryland’s reputation as a crucial breeding ground for college soccer.

Profile: Naval Academy Men’s Soccer

The United States Naval Academy, located in Annapolis, is another significant contributor to Maryland’s college soccer scene through the Navy Midshipmen Men’s Soccer team. The team has a storied history dating back to 1911, showcasing over a century’s worth of victories, challenges, and growth. They’ve had notable seasons, including their 1964 campaign in which they reached the NCAA final.

While not as traditionally successful as the University of Maryland in terms of championships, the Navy Men’s Soccer team has consistently been competitive while fulfilling the Naval Academy’s larger mission of preparing athletes for military and civic service. The team has also produced significant players, such as Joseph Greenspan, who later played professionally in the Major League Soccer. The team takes pride in its disciplined approach to soccer, reflecting the military ethos of the Academy as a whole.

Introducing the Loyola University Maryland Men’s Soccer Team

Nestled in the heart of Baltimore, Loyola University Maryland is a private Jesuit institution that plays host to the esteemed Loyola Greyhounds Men’s Soccer team. The team brings a strong reputation to the field, showcasing its talents in the competitive Patriot League, built on a rich heritage of exceptional performance and achievement in the sport.

Under the influential tutelage of renowned coach Bill Sento, who spearheaded the team from the mid-1980s through to the early 2010s, the Greyhounds cemented their status as the most successful men’s soccer program in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ference history. The team advanced to the NCAA tournament nine times within his leadership. A significant alumni, Zach Thornton, went on to partake in a celebrated career in Major League Soccer and earned several caps with the U.S. National team.

At the heart of the Greyhounds soccer operation is a comprehensive approach to player development, which combines athletic prowess with personal growth. This commitment, aligned with the university’s Jesuit principles, has reaped dividends and garnered the team continued recognition within college soccer and beyond.

Recruitment Trends Among Maryland College Soccer Teams

Recruitment trends have also evolved over the years. Previously, Maryland College Soccer teams predominantly scouted talent from local high school competitions. However, in recent years there’s been a shift to scattered recruitment strategies. Now teams are scouting both nationally and internationally, leveraging online platforms to achieve this. The recruitment process has become more digitalized and includes detailed talent analytics performed on potential recruits.
